STUNNA-K In reply to Siregar3D [2016-01-18 22:07:14 +0000 UTC]

Thanks! i'm glad you appreciate it. This design will forever be one of my babies lol. Regarding recoil, I know for a fact that the Hk-style sliding stocks used on G3s do not have buffer tubes, so I imagine the felt recoil would be comparable with those models. Muzzle flip would be higher since the weight would be shifted towards the rear, but it's probably nothing a good comp or muzzle brake can't fix. There are quite a few existing high power bullpup rifles that lack recoil buffers such as the 7.62x51 RFB or the 7.62x54 SVU... i'm sure they kick like donkeys, but it can be done.

TheMintyCrab In reply to Tevo77777 [2014-06-13 19:04:23 +0000 UTC]

First of all, the G3 and it's cousins (eg HK53, MP5, etc.) all work by means of a roller-delayed blowback system. As such, they have no gas system.
(+ of course the gas system would work if you converted a conventional battle rifle to a bullpup one; the gas system is basically the only part of the weapon which you wouldn't modify)
Also, the recoil has nothing to do with whether or not the weapon is a bullpup.

STUNNA-K In reply to exizt [2014-03-25 06:19:09 +0000 UTC]

they there, thanks for taking a look. I appreciate your comment. I am also very aware of the importance of eye relief and took careful notice to research the length of the eye relief and positioning of the susat scope on this rifle. susats have very low eye relief distance and the ocular lens sits very close to the shooter's eye. also, combine this with the usual long length of bullpup stocks, and you get an optic that looks like it's sitting unusually close to the face of the shooter x) take a look for yourself and look up a few bullpups with their original-proprietary optics - F2000, L85, AUG A1... you'll notice the back end of the all of their optics sit far behind the pistol grips.
